Japan Ceramsite Market Supply Chain: From Raw Materials to End-Use

The supply chain for ceramsite in Japan is a complex network involving raw material sourcing, manufacturing, distribution, and end-use application. Raw materials such as clay, shale, and industrial by-products are sourced locally and internationally, with quality control being paramount. Manufacturing involves high-temperature calcination, requiring advanced kilns and energy-efficient processes to meet Japan’s strict environmental standards.

Distribution channels include direct sales to construction firms, specialty distributors, and online platforms. End-use sectors are primarily construction, environmental remediation, and agriculture. The integration of digital logistics solutions enhances supply chain efficiency, reducing lead times and costs. The industry’s focus on sustainable sourcing and manufacturing practices aligns with Japan’s environmental policies, influencing procurement decisions and supplier relationships.

What is ceramsite, and why is it important in Japan?

Ceramsite is a lightweight, porous aggregate used in construction, environmental remediation, and agriculture. Its importance in Japan stems from the country’s focus on sustainable building practices and environmental protection.
